    Abstract: Selection of a relay station in a broadband wireless communication system is provided. In the broadband wireless communication system, a Base Station (BS) includes a sorter for generating a first index group in which indices of relay stations are sorted according to channel information between the BS and each relay station; a receiver for receiving a second index group in which the indices of the relay stations are sorted according to channel information between a Mobile Station (MS) and each relay station; and a selector for selecting a relay station to be used to communicate with the MS by using the first index group and the second index group.

    Abstract: A frequency allocation method and apparatus using a mirroring-assisted frequency hopping pattern is provided for retransmission in a wireless communication system operating in frequency hopping mode. A frequency allocation method for a wireless communication system operating in frequency hopping mode includes generating a mirroring pattern having a mirroring-assisted frequency hopping interval identical with a data retransmission interval; and allocating different frequency bands for an initial transmission and retransmission by performing frequency hopping according to the mirroring pattern. Preferably, the mirroring-assisted frequency hopping interval is shorter than the data retransmission interval.

    Abstract: A sounding reference signal transmission method which is efficient in an uplink wireless telecommunications system using a multiple antenna technique and sounding reference signal hopping. A terminal using the multiple antenna technique is equipped with a plurality of antennas, and a base station receives the sounding reference signal transmitted from these antennas and estimates the uplink channel state of each antenna. Moreover, the sounding reference signal performs frequency hopping so that the base station determines the channel condition for the entire bandwidth to which data is transmitted in the uplink system. The sounding reference signal is transmitted through an antenna pattern in which the sounding reference signal can be transmitted through the entire data transmission bandwidth of the uplink system for each antenna of the terminal without additional overhead in this environment.

    Abstract: Provided is a method for transmitting an uplink Channel Sounding (CS) Reference Signal (RS) channel in a wireless communication system. The method includes transmitting symbols of the CS RS channel through an entire system band in a previously selected at least one of Long Blocks (LBs) constituting one time slot of a subframe; and transmitting symbols of control channels through a predetermined band in LBs remaining after symbols of the CS RS channel are applied in the time slot, by applying an orthogonal sequence determined according to the number of LBs to which symbols of the CS RS channel are applied.

    Abstract: An apparatus and method for allocating resources in an Single Carrier-Frequency Division Multiple Access (SC-FDMA) communication system are provided, in which a Node B determines on a cell basis whether to turn or off inter-subband hopping and whether to turn on or off mirroring for a resource unit for the UE on a frequency axis along which at least two subbands are defined, at set hopping times, selects a resource unit by selectively performing inter-subband hopping and mirroring on the resource unit for the UE according to the determination, and allocates the selected resource unit to the UE.

    Abstract: An apparatus and method for allocating resources in an Single Carrier-Frequency Division Multiple Access (SC-FDMA) communication system are provided, in which a Node B performs inter-subband hopping on a resource unit for a User Equipment (UE) on a frequency axis along which at least two subbands are defined, at each predetermined hopping time, determines whether to turn on or off mirroring in a subband having the hopped resource unit on a cell basis at the each hopping time, selects a resource unit by selectively mirroring the hopped unit according to the determination, and allocates the selected resource unit to the UE.

    Abstract: A channel estimation method in a wireless communication system based on multicarrier-code division multiple access (MC-CDMA) using frequency interleaving. A transmitter generates transmission symbols using a pilot signal (P) and an inverted pilot signal (?P) according to subcarriers on which spread symbols generated from a spectrum spreading operation are sent, performs an interleaving operation for the transmission symbols in a frequency domain, and transmits a result of the interleaving operation. A receiver extracts the pilot signal (P) and inverted pilot signal (?P) included in the transmission symbols and performs channel estimation.
